Geographic location and significance of West Africa

Burkina Faso is located in the heart of West Africa and is of strategic importance to the region. It borders six countries: Mali to the north, Niger to the east, Benin to the southeast, Togo and Ghana to the south, and Côte d'Ivoire to the southwest. This central location allows Burkina Faso to serve as a hub for trade and cultural exchange. However, its predominantly landlocked position also poses challenges, particularly regarding access to maritime routes and international markets. Nevertheless, the Country benefits from its neighbors by establishing trade routes and economic cooperation that contribute to regional stability.

When you travel to Burkina Faso, you experience an adventure that takes you deep into the heart of West Africa. It is advisable to inform yourself in advance about local customs and practices; Burkinabè appreciate it when you respect their culture and try their Language at least a little. Even though French is widely spoken, learning a few words in local dialects like Mooré or Dioula can greatly enrich your interactions. During your explorations, be Sure to use local means of transportation like motorcycle taxis or minibuses. These not only provide you with an authentic insight into the daily lives of people, but also the chance to engage with friendly locals.

Secure a good travel health insurance, as medical facilities are often limited. Vaccinations for hepatitis A and yellow fever are recommended, and it is advisable to have mosquito nets for overnight stays in rural areas. The best travel times for Burkina Faso

The best travel times for Burkina Faso are usually between November and March, when the weather is the most pleasant. During this time, temperatures are typically between 20 and 30 degrees Celsius, and the humidity is low. This period allows you to fully enjoy the sights and attractions of the Country while escaping the intense summer heat, which can often be unbearable. Additionally, the few rainy days fall during this time, making it easier to explore the National Parks and rural areas.

The rainy season from May to October can be visually spectacular, as Nature transforms into a lush green dress, but it also carries certain risks. Roads can become impassable, and many rural areas are then difficult to reach. For adventure seekers who wish to observe the blooming Flora and Fauna of the Country during these months, it can, however, be a fascinating experience. Preparatory measures are crucial, such as carrying mosquito nets and appropriate clothing.

Safety and health care for travelers

When traveling to Burkina Faso, it is important to inform yourself about the security situation in the country. Security conditions can change rapidly regionally, so it is advisable to consult current information from official sources and travel warnings. Despite some challenges the Country faces from external threats, most travelers experience a positive atmosphere. Avoid traveling to remote areas, especially at night, and be cautious at political gatherings or demonstrations. Make Sure to keep your valuables in a safe place and choose accommodations in trusted neighborhoods.

Healthcare in Burkina Faso can vary, especially in rural areas. In larger cities, there are some public and private healthcare facilities; however, the equipment is not always at Western standards. A Travel pharmacy with essential medications as well as personal health products is strongly recommended. Consider getting vaccinated against certain diseases before departure, with Hepatitis A, Typhoid, and Yellow Fever being among the most common. Agricultural or foreign infections, such as Malaria, are also a risk; therefore, it is advisable to use mosquito nets and preventive medications. Your stay in Burkina Faso may be marred by high fever or stomach problems, so only eat well-cooked Food or peeled fruit to minimize potential health risks.

In terms of emergencies, it is helpful to have the contact numbers of the local embassy or consulates on hand while you are in Burkina Faso. It is also practical to befriend locals who can provide valuable information about medical facilities or pharmacies nearby. This way, you are better prepared to address unforeseen health issues. Culinary journey

Culinary journey

Burkina Faso is a culinary Paradise that delights your taste buds with an exciting palette of flavors and traditions. The undiscovered delicacies waiting for you here reflect the diversity of cultural influences. An essential staple is the popular "To," a thick polenta made from cassava or sorghum, often served with delicious sauces made from peanuts and vegetables. This combination is not only nutritious but also an example of the imaginative use of local ingredients. During your visit, be Sure to take the opportunity to observe the preparation of To and perhaps even lend a hand. You might be fortunate enough to attend a feast where this specialty is served in generous portions to unite the community.

Another highlight of your culinary journey is the street Food stalls typical in the cities and villages. Here you can try the popular "brochettes," grilled meat skewers prepared with a flavorful marinade of herbs and spices. Grab a few skewers and enjoy them with a side of "fritures," crispy fried vegetables or fish, perfectly seasoned. The melting pot of flavors at these stalls gives you the opportunity to interact with locals and learn their secret recipes. This not only provides insight into the culinary culture but also into the lifestyle of the Burkinabè, evident in every bite.

Don't forget to explore the refreshing beverages, often based on fresh fruits or traditional methods. A popular refreshment is "bissap," a hibiscus-based tea served cold with a wonderfully fruity note. These drinks are the perfect accompaniment to your meals and enhance the culinary experience even further. Tasting local snacks and sweets made with coconut, peanuts, or honey will complete your flavor journey. The burkinabé cuisine is not Just about Food but a social experience that brings People together and tells stories.
